# _download_java_source_matches(%args)
# Downloads Maven source jars when local archive lookup cannot satisfy the requested Java class.
# Input: path registry object, fully qualified class name string, and relative Java source path string.
# Output: ordered list of extracted Java source file path strings.
sub _download_java_source_matches {
my (%args) = @_;
my $paths = $args{paths} || die 'Missing path registry';
my $name = $args{name} || return;
my $relative = $args{relative} || return;
my @matches;
for my $doc ( _maven_search_documents($name) ) {
next if ref($doc) ne 'HASH';
next if !grep { defined && $_ eq '-sources.jar' } @{ $doc->{ec} || [] };
my $archive = _download_maven_source_jar( paths => $paths, doc => $doc ) or next;
push @matches,
_extract_java_sources_from_archive(
paths => $paths,
archive => $archive,
relative => $relative,
);
last if @matches;
}
return @matches;
}
# _maven_search_documents($name)
# Queries Maven Central for one fully qualified Java class name.
# Input: fully qualified Java class name string.
# Output: ordered list of Maven search document hash references.
sub _maven_search_documents {
my ($name) = @_;
return if !defined $name || $name eq '';
my $query = uri_escape_utf8(qq{fc:"$name"});
my $url = "https://search.maven.org/solrsearch/select?q=$query&rows=20&wt=json";
my $ua = LWP::UserAgent->new( timeout => 10 );
my $res = $ua->get($url);
return if !$res->is_success;
my $payload = eval { decode_json( $res->decoded_content ) };
return if !$payload || ref($payload) ne 'HASH';
return @{ $payload->{response}{docs} || [] };
}
# _download_maven_source_jar(%args)
# Downloads one Maven Central source jar into the dashboard cache tree when it is missing.
# Input: path registry object and one Maven search document hash reference.
# Output: local source-jar path string or undef on failure.
sub _download_maven_source_jar {
my (%args) = @_;
my $paths = $args{paths} || die 'Missing path registry';
my $doc = $args{doc} || return;
return if ref($doc) ne 'HASH';
return if !defined $doc->{g} || !defined $doc->{a} || !defined $doc->{v};
my $group_path = join '/', split /\./, $doc->{g};
my $file = "$doc->{a}-$doc->{v}-sources.jar";
my $target = File::Spec->catfile(
$paths->cache_root,
'open-file',
'maven-sources',
split( /\//, $group_path ),
$doc->{a},
$doc->{v},
$file,
);
return $target if -f $target;
my ( $volume, $directories ) = File::Spec->splitpath($target);
make_path( File::Spec->catpath( $volume, $directories, '' ) );
my $url = join '/',
'https://repo1.maven.org/maven2',
$group_path,
$doc->{a},
$doc->{v},
$file;
my $ua = LWP::UserAgent->new( timeout => 20 );
my $res = $ua->mirror( $url, $target );
return if !$res->is_success && $res->code != 304;
return -f $target ? $target : undef;
}
